
About this episode
Andrea Catherwood explores listener feedback on Broadcasting House and discusses crisis management in media.
Andrea Catherwood meets with Paddy O'Connell, longtime presenter of Broadcasting House. But this time we're going behind the scenes as Paddy has granted the Feedback team special access to the programme's inbox - and like Feedback's listeners, Broadcasting House's listeners have a lot to say. And how do you get the balance right when reporting on news during a day that is supposed to be dedicated to calm? Paddy gives his thoughts. And some listeners had questions about a recent episode of Any Answers. Why did it only deal with one subject? Finally, it's time for another edition of our VoxBox - this time it's two friends and PR professionals, Lauren and Dan, giving their take on the BBC's programme all about crisis management, When It Hits The Fan. Does the series do its best to inform, educate, and entertain, or is it all spin?
